Res No 058-25-16350RESOLUTION NO.058-25-16350 A RESOLUTION OF THE MAYOR AND C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F SOUTH MIAMI, FLORIDA,APPROVING THE NAMING OF 64TH STREET BETWEEN 67TH COURT AND 68TH COURT IN HONOR OF R.PAUL YOUNG;PROVIDING FOR IMPLEMENTATION,TRANSMITTAL,CORRECTIONS, SEVERABILITY,AND A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S,R.Paul Young,a pillar of the South Miami community whose decades of service uplifted countless lives,passed away on June 10,2025;and WHEREAS,R.Paul Young served the City of South Miami (the “City”)as Vice Mayor from 1994 to 1996 and as City Commissioner from 1 996 to 1998;and WHEREAS,he championed youth and education through his service on the Marshall Williamson Scholarship Committee,helping local students—especially those from disadvantaged backgrounds—achieve their dreams through scholarship awards;and WHEREAS,R.Paul Young brought a wealth of experience from his distinguished professional career in the fields of education,government,healthcare,and labor,including over 25 years of experience as an adjunct professor at Miami Dade College and key leadership roles as Grants Administrator for Miami-Dade County Public Schools,Regional Manager for the Florida Department of Labor,and Executive Director of the Primary Health Care Consortium of Dade County;and WHEREAS,his commitment to public service also extended to his work with numerous other institutions,including the James L.Knight Center,Coconut Grove Exhibition Center,City of Riviera Beach,and the University of Miami;and WHEREAS,R.Paul Young’s lifelong dedication to empowering others and strengthening communities leaves a legacy that will never be forgotten;and WHEREAS,Section 17-10.1 “Guidelines for Naming City Property and Roadways”of the City Code of Ordinances (the “Code”)allows for the naming of a public street or piece of public property following the passing of the person to be honored;and WHEREAS,the City Commission desires to honor R.Paul Young’s memory and legacy by naming 64th Street between 67th Court and 68th Court (the “Designated Street”)after R.Paul Young;and WHEREAS,the City Commission finds that this Resolution is in the best interest and welfare of the City. NOW,THEREFORE,BE IT RESOLVED BY THE MAYOR AND C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F SOUTH MIAMI,FLORIDA,AS FOLLOWS: Page 1 of 2 Res.No.058-25-16350 Section 1.Recitals.The above-stated recitals are true and correct and are incorporated herein by this reference. Section 2.Approving the Naming of the Designated Street in Honor of R.Paul Young.The City Commission hereby approves the naming of the Designated Street in honor of R.Paul Young. Section 3 Implementation.The City Manager is hereby authorized to take any and all action necessary to implement the purposes of this Resolution.The appropriate City departments are hereby authorized to erect the necessary street signs,subject to any necessary coordination with or approval from Miami-Dade County. Section 4.Transmittal.This Resolution shall be transmitted to Miami-Dade County for approval. Section 5.Corrections.Conforming language or technical scrivener-type corrections may be made by the City Attorney for any conforming amendments to be incorporated into the final resolution for signature. Section 6.Severability.If any section,clause,sentence,or phrase of this Resolution is for any reason held invalid or unconstitutional by a court of competent jurisdiction,the holding shall not affect the validity of the remaining portions of this Resolution. Section 7.Effective Date.This Resolution shall become effective immediately upon adoption. PASSED AND ADOPTED this 29lh day of July,2025.
